| dc.description.abstract | We demonstrate and analyze the first mid-infrared on-chip Brillouin laser generated using chalcogenide resonators. Q-factor of 2.91 × 107, phonon gain bandwidth of 14.51 MHz and threshold power of 93.3 μW were measured. | en |
